π Supporting Coach Chris Huggins — Chuck-a-Puck Recap
Our Jr. Blues family came together in an inspiring show of support for Coach Chris Huggins in his Stage 4 cancer fight.
With nearly $10,000 raised ($8,000 online + $1,185 at the arena), the community rallied in the most unbelievable way.
